P0238: Turbocharger Boost Sensor A Circuit High
Can you still drive? Driving is not recommended if the engine is overboosting. Excessive boost can cause severe engine damage. Have it towed if necessary.
What Does P0238 Mean?
Code P0238 means the turbocharger boost pressure sensor is reporting a voltage that exceeds the expected maximum. This could indicate an overboosting condition, a shorted sensor circuit, or a faulty sensor itself. The ECM may engage limp mode to protect the engine from excessive boost pressure.

Browse OBD-II Scanners on AmazonCommon Causes
- Faulty boost pressure sensor
- Short circuit in sensor wiring
- Stuck wastegate causing overboost
- Faulty ECM
Symptoms
- Check engine light on
- Vehicle enters limp mode
- Excessive boost pressure
- Rough running engine
- Poor fuel economy
Diagnostic Steps
- 1Read freeze frame data and note boost pressure readings
- 2Inspect boost sensor wiring for shorts or chafing
- 3Test sensor output with a multimeter
- 4Check wastegate operation manually
- 5Compare actual boost to sensor reading with a mechanical gauge

Frequently Asked Questions
Can P0238 cause engine damage?
Yes, if the high reading reflects actual overboost, excessive pressure can damage pistons, head gaskets, and the turbo itself.
Is P0238 just a sensor issue?
It can be, but you should verify with a mechanical boost gauge. If actual boost is normal, it's likely a sensor or wiring fault.
